Understanding LTE Tower Structures

LTE (Long-Term Evolution) tower structures serve as the backbone of mobile communication networks. They are designed to transmit and receive signals, ensuring seamless connectivity for users. The efficiency of these structures directly impacts network performance and user experience.

Common Types of LTE Tower Structures

  • Lattice Towers: Made of steel, offering high strength and durability.
  • Monopole Towers: Sleeker design, less visual impact, suitable for urban areas.
  • Guyed Towers: Tall and efficient, supported by guy wires, ideal for rural settings.

Importance of Optimal Placement

The placement of LTE tower structures significantly affects signal strength and coverage. Towers should be situated based on geographical data and urban development plans to minimize dead zones. Research indicates that optimal placements can increase coverage areas by up to 40%.

Infrastructure Challenges

Despite the need for extensive coverage, many regions face infrastructure challenges. Regulatory restrictions, zoning laws, and community opposition can delay tower installations. Adapting to these challenges is essential for maximizing connectivity.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the main components of an LTE tower structure?

An LTE tower typically consists of a base station, antennas, and transmission equipment. Additional features may include backup power supplies and cooling systems operational in diverse environments.

How do weather conditions affect LTE tower performance?

Weather conditions such as heavy rain, snow, or high winds can impact signal transmission. Towers are designed with weather resilience in mind, incorporating materials that withstand extreme conditions.

What role do LTE tower structures play in 5G rollout?

LTE towers are essential for the intermediate phase leading to 5G, facilitating the transition by supporting existing LTE users while upgrading infrastructure for higher capacities in 5G networks.
